Eve Guzman: Earning 7-Figures and Helping Over 1M Clients as a Nutrition Coach 

Eve Guzman, MLS (ASCP), MBA is a medical laboratory scientist, nutritionist, researcher, speaker, and business coach for fitness coaches. She’s also a macro nutrition expert with 23 years of experience, which is the foundation for her role as CEO of MacroU — a metabolism and macro nutrition coaching company which aims to help women improve their health, ditch fad diets, lose weight, and eat real food without being restricted.

Eve also helps coaches build confidence in handling complex health cases—like hormonal imbalances and stalled weight loss—using a root-cause, macro-based approach to nutrition. Through her nutrition coaching and business certification program, she helps coaches become certified macro nutrition coaches, equipping them with the skills and strategies they need to succeed.

She started her business because she saw a need for more evidence-based coaching in the nutrition space. Through her programs — which includes coaching, courses, and certifications — Eve has built a 7-figure business that has certified over 1,700 nutrition coaches and has helped a combined 1.1 million clients to date.

“As a Black entrepreneur, my journey has taught me the importance of resilience, authenticity, and creating opportunities for others,” says Eve.

“It’s shaped my commitment to empowering coaches—not just with the knowledge to deliver exceptional results, but with the tools to build businesses that reflect their values and create lasting, positive change in their communities who didn’t grow up learning about nutrition and fitness.”

Eve’s advice to the next generation of Black entrepreneurs and creators is to stay rooted in your mission and never underestimate the power of your voice. 

“Embrace what makes you unique—it’s your superpower,” she says. “Remember that success isn’t just about the results you achieve, but about the impact you bring to your work. Stay consistent, stay curious, and trust that your perspective is needed.”

Dr. Simone Ellis: Achieving Six-Figure Success and Impacting Thousands of Healthcare Professionals

Dr. Simone Ellis is a thought leader, entrepreneur, and coach who has transformed the landscape of healthcare and business, particularly in the dental industry. After 15 years of practicing dentistry and eventually selling her practice, Dr. Simone has built and sold multiple multimillion-dollar practices. She now uses her experience to help high-performing doctors and healthcare professionals achieve financial freedom by increasing revenue and building systems of peace and productivity.

Her journey began when she recognized the lack of resources and mentorship available to minority professionals in healthcare. 

“Navigating the challenges as a woman of color in a predominantly male industry taught me resilience and the importance of representation,” she says.

“I wanted to break barriers and create pathways for others, showing that success is achievable regardless of background. This mission continues to fuel my passion and shapes my approach to leadership and business.”

Dr. Simone offers coaching, leadership training, and business consulting to help doctors create successful, patient-centric practices. Additionally, she mentors young professionals, particularly African-American women in healthcare, guiding them through challenges and inspiring them to build impactful legacies.

She’s achieved six-figure success through her coaching programs, speaking engagements, and brand partnerships. Dr. Simone has also impacted thousands of healthcare professionals by helping them create sustainable, patient-focused practices while achieving financial independence.

“Dream big, but work even bigger,” she says. “Surround yourself with people who challenge you to grow and stay true to your mission. Most importantly, remember that your voice and story matter—use them to inspire and uplift others.”

Kerry Marshall Jr.: Building a Six-Figure Membership Platform Teaching Guitar 

Kerry Marshall Jr. is the owner and founder of Kerry’s Kamp, an online guitar learning platform dedicated to helping musicians master R&B, Neo-Soul, and Gospel guitar.

At Kerry’s Kamp, Kerry provides structured lessons, mentorship, and a supportive community for guitarists who want to develop their skills. The program focuses on practical techniques, feel, and groove, helping musicians at all levels break out of the box and truly express themselves through music.

He started Kerry’s Kamp because he saw a gap in the guitar education space—there weren’t enough resources focused on the feel and emotion of R&B, Neo-Soul, and Gospel.

“As a Black entrepreneur and musician, my journey has been about staying authentic, overcoming barriers, and building a community that makes learning accessible to all,” says Kerry.

“Representation matters, and I wanted to create a space where aspiring musicians could see someone like them excelling and teaching.”

Having appeared on countless shows including Good Morning America and the Jimmy Kimmel Show, one of his favorite parts of his job is seeing the transformation in his students. “Watching someone go from struggling with basic chords to confidently playing soulful licks and expressing themselves through their guitar is incredibly rewarding.”

Since creating Kerry’s Kamp on Kajabi, Kerry has built his membership platform to over $400K in revenue. 

“I’ve been able to help thousands of guitarists worldwide, and that impact means more than any dollar amount,” says Kerry. “Stay consistent, stay authentic, and build something that truly serves people. Don’t be afraid to take risks, and always keep learning. Surround yourself with a strong community, and remember that success isn’t just about money—it’s about impact.”

Rosemary Lewis: Scaling Real Estate Bestie to a Multiple Six-Figure Business 

Rosemary Lewis is a real estate broker, coach, and the creator of Real Estate Bestie. After spending 14 years as an elementary school teacher, Rosemary uses her background in education to teach women in real estate how to build multiple six-figure businesses that are authentic and sustainable.

Through digital courses, coaching, masterminds, and community, Rosemary equips agents with the strategies, systems, and confidence to succeed. Whether it’s through her Real Estate Bestie Accelerator or her YouTube content, she provides real-world insights and faith-based encouragement to help agents get unstuck and take action.

Real estate can be overwhelming for new agents, but through her programs on Kajabi, Rosemary’s mission is to make sure no agent feels like they’re figuring it out alone.

“As a Black entrepreneur, I’ve learned that representation matters,” she says. “Many of us didn’t grow up seeing examples of Black women thriving in business ownership, especially in real estate. That’s why I’m intentional about showing up and sharing my journey."

"I want to be the example that I didn’t always have, so the next generation knows that success is possible for them, too.”

Real Estate Bestie has grown into a multiple six-figure business. More importantly, Rosemary has had the privilege of helping hundreds of women realtors create businesses that fund their families, build generational wealth, and allow them to live life on their terms. “Through my coaching programs, masterminds, and free content, I’ve equipped realtors with the tools to confidently close more deals, create consistent income, and show up powerfully in their communities,” she says.”

Gahmya Drummond-Bey: Earning Over Six Figures and Securing Global Reach 

Gahmya Drummond-Bey is the founder of Evolved Teacher, a learning and empowerment platform that provides personal growth programs for children and those who teach them. As an educator, curriculum designer, and coach, Gahmya’s goal is to help prepare the next generation to be healthy digital and global citizens. Her program also helps leaders, organizations, and schools to create programs that are more transformational and fitting for today's evolved kid.

Gahmya decided to start her business after teaching in over 30 countries and realizing there are similarities among the world's most happy, healthy, and academically successful children. She also found that there was a gap in support that those children needed to achieve their own dreams.

Since launching on Kajabi, Evolved Teacher has earned multiple six figures in revenue and reached over 60 countries.

“My advice for encouraging the next generation of Black entrepreneurs and creators is to never water down your edge,” says Gahmya.

“We all have something about us that is unique—and oftentimes, as minorities, we are told to hide that. Don't. Lean in—you'll be glad you did and your audience will, too.”
